SAVE
SAVE is an engineering and consultancy bureau focusing on advice, safety and system analysis. SAVE was established in 1983 and now has 40 advisors. It has been part of the Oranjewoud organization since January 1, 2003.

Knowledge and experience
SAVE's knowledge and experience is in the following specific fields:

- risk analysis and safety studies

- safety management

- corporate fire departments

- organization and capacity of regional and municipal fire departments

- fire safety engineering

- emergency preparedness planning

- systems analysis

These skills and know-how are employed in projects for governmental bodies and corporations. The projects may be technical or organisatorial in nature or about developing policies. SAVE's lengthy track record in the external safety and firefighting fields means that it has a broad base of knowledge about developments both inside the Netherlands and further a field, as well as the methods and relevant regulations available.

NVVK

 

The Dutch Safety Association is the knowledgeplatform for safety specialists in The Netherlands. They organize a yearly congres, launch initiatives like thesis-competitions and lectures and are editor of the NVVK-magazine. The associations patron Prof. Mr. Pieter van Vollenhoven is (apart from member of the Royal Family) former chairman of the Onderzoeksraad voor Veiligheid (Dutch Central Safety Council).

Apart from offering a network of specialists and all relevant information, NVVK is actively involved in discussions and changes concerning law and regulation. Also NVVK is responsible for the professional representations of the interest of her members. The Association focuses on five domains of safety: labor, extern, consumer, patients and transport. On all domains several workgroups are actively involved.
